brocsdad Added a reply to 2024 YZ 250F Review
12/4/2023 12:27pm The base design of the motor is the same but the airbox, cam, cam chain and mapping are different. The 24 is stronger mid thru top than 23 with a Twisted Vortex, screen elimination kit and FMF slip on.

brocsdad Added a reply to 2024 YZ 250F Review
11/30/2023 8:54am The Stevie is very similar with a little more engine braking. The TP map was in the older models and not for the 24. For 24 you have the following: 1). Keefer Aggressive 2). Keefer Free Feeling 3). Responsive (Regains low end of previous years but harder hitting) 4). Stevie - (Yamaha Employee at Test Track)
